Partial day rehabs are centers where people receive substance abuse treatment services throughout the day after which return home every day when treatment is complete. Partial day rehab is sometimes favored over a more involved program requiring either an inpatient stay in a healthcare facility or perhaps a residential stay in a residential drug and alcohol rehab program or therapeutic community. This is primarily because it offers a lot of flexibility so that the individual can keep up with their responsibilities and regular way of life while still undergoing treatment services. Partial day rehab is also a cheaper option, because individuals only paying for the rehabilitation rather than the amenities required in an inpatient or residential alcohol and drug rehab facility. Most partial day rehabs provide rehabilitation in the medical center or mental health hospital or clinic, and these facilities provide you with the typical rehab services that might normally be offered in almost any other standard drug rehabilitation program. Partial day rehab also is a worthwhile aftercare alternative for someone who has already finished treatment within an inpatient or residential drug treatment facility. This will provide extra support and recovery solutions needed for individuals who need to have this outlet while they manage to get their lives back to normal.
